‘Dekh raha hai Binod, Season 4 aa raha hai’ Yes, you heard that right! Panchayat Season 4 is finally going to be released on 2nd July 2025, on Amazon Prime Video. Abhishek Tripathi – Jitendra Kumar
Rinky – Sanvikaa
Manju Devi – Neena Gupta
Brij Bhushan Dubey – Raghubir Yadav
Prahlad Pandey – Faisal Malik
Vikas – Chandan Roy
Vinod – Ashok Pathak
Bhushan Sharma – Durgesh Kumar
Kranti Devi – Sunita Rajwar
Chandrakishore Singh (Vidhayak Ji) – Pankaj Jha
Ganesh – Aasif Khan
Saansad (Member of Parliament) – Swanand Kirkire
The protagonist and Gram Sachiv (village secretary) of Phulera. Abhishek (Avisek?) is a city boy thrust into rural administration, reluctantly at first, but gradually finds purpose and connection with the people around him. His sarcasm, practicality, and growth arc form the emotional core of the series. Also, it remains to be seen whether he finally achieves his MBA aspirations or not!
Daughter of Manju Devi and Brij Bhushan Dubey. Quiet, laid-back, and independent, Rinky gradually emerges as a potential love interest for Abhishek. Though she’s not the most vocal when compared to the rest of the Panchayat Cast, her presence has grown significantly, and fans are keen to see her role expand in Season 4.
The official Pradhan (village head), although her husband mostly takes the reins. Initially uninterested in administrative duties, Manju Devi shows increasing confidence and leadership over time, offering a sharp blend of tradition and evolving empowerment.
Manju Devi’s husband and the de facto leader of Phulera. Pradhan Ji is wise, politically savvy, and deeply respected. He often offers guidance to Abhishek and navigates village matters with a unique blend of old-school charm, modern understanding, and lauki!
Deputy Pradhan and a close friend of Sachiv Ji, Pradhan Ji and Vikas. Prahlad’s character, especially in Season 3, takes a more emotional turn as he deals with personal loss. Loyal, thoughtful, and deeply human, he adds emotional depth to the story.
Abhishek’s ever-helpful office assistant and friend. Vikas brings light-heartedness to the show with his innocent outlook and genuine concern for others. He often acts as the bridge between Abhishek and the villagers.
A recurring village character who often pops up with comic timing. Vinod might be a background character, but he adds to the authenticity of village life and often delivers small but memorable moments.
The show’s most vocal and comical troublemaker. Bhushan sees himself as a political rival to Pradhan Ji and never misses a chance to stir drama. Often referred to as “Banrakas”, Bhushan is loud, stubborn, and unintentionally hilarious, something that makes him a fan favourite amongst all the cast of Panchayat.
Bhushan’s wife and fellow rabble-rouser. Kranti Devi supports her husband’s political aspirations and often joins him in causing chaos. Her eye rolls and arguments are scene-stealers in their own right.
A politically powerful character whose motives are often unclear. As the area’s MLA, he influences major decisions and brings a top-down political presence into the otherwise grassroot show. In the last season, he played a major role in the plot, and while he is shown in a negative light, his final conversation with Sitara was a tearjerker. Did he order the hit on Pradhan Ji? A recurring side character, Damaad Ji is known for some of the most iconic scenes of the series. From claiming his Chakke wala kursi to going to Vidhayak Ji’s compound to “buy” his horse, Ganesh is a quirky personality who is unpredictable, comic, and a fan favourite.
Although we have only seen a cameo of Sansaad Ji in Season 3, it is expected that he will be playing a much more consequential role in Season 4.
Besides these, characters like Bam Bahadur, Parmeshwar, Madhav, Babloo Dabloo, etc., have also played a notable role in making the series what it is.
